Transaction 5d69a8d41a3f32fe3b3144a229398628e2fb45c30e9264b3c77a039c295ec3a7
1 Input
2 Outputs
- 5d69a8d41a3f32fe3b3144a229398628e2fb45c30e9264b3c77a039c295ec3a7:0
- 5d69a8d41a3f32fe3b3144a229398628e2fb45c30e9264b3c77a039c295ec3a7:1
value 2164536
address 15fuYhJv3uo7PT8kHZ24X7zrXyewh89dpc
value 31731894
address 145hYP6wQYXN7CKZEzut3YkoHozbmdog3W